You can add a Medicare Supplement plan and/or a standalone Medicare Prescription Drug plan to Original Medicare (Parts A & B). You cannot have a Medicare Supplement plan and a Medicare Advantage plan at the similar time. If you do not make any changes throughout AEP, your present plan will routinely renew the subsequent yr. The Special Enrollment Period allows you to enroll in Original Medicare outdoors of your IEP because of sure life changes. For instance, you may wait to enroll if you're nonetheless working.

As a common rule, people who plan to proceed to work (and have employer-sponsored health coverage) previous age 65 have to check with the employer-sponsored health plan to see whether they need to enroll in Part B or not. Some of UC’s retiree medical plans have Medicare versions and a few have a corresponding associate plan (UC Care, CORE, UC Blue & Gold). If your present retiree plan has a Medicare version or partner plan, you’ll be transferred into that plan whenever you turn 65, as soon as Medicare has approved your enrollment form.

Turning 65 is the set off level for the vast majority of Americans to enroll in Medicare. Since the Social Security Administration handles enrollments, you'll sometimes enroll at the Social Security office nearest you or online at SSA.gov. Failing to enroll in Medicare on time could cost you, so take note of the assorted enrollment options outlined under to keep from getting hit with a penalty for missing the sign-up window.

In 2020, ninety% of Medicare Advantage plans supply prescription drug coverage (MA-PDs), and most Medicare Advantage enrollees (89%) are in plans that embrace this prescription drug coverage. Nearly two-thirds of these beneficiaries (60%) pay no premium for their plan, aside from the Medicare Part B premium ($144.60 in 2020). However, 18 % of beneficiaries in MA-PDs (2.8 million enrollees) pay at least $50 per month, including 6 % who pay $one hundred or extra per month, in addition to the monthly Part B premium.
